Following the directive of Article 41 of the Indian Constitution, NSAP(National Social Assistance Programme) was launced in our country on the 15th day of August in 1995. Since then, the programme has been running successfully in every state of the country. At present, number of beneficiaries under this popular scheme in India is 29747907.
The programme has four major components – IGNOAPS (Indira Gandhi National Old Age Pension Scheme), IGNWPS (Indira Gandhi National Widow Pension Scheme), IGNDPS (Indira Gandhi National Disability Pension Scheme) and NFBS (National Family Benefit Scheme).

- Each pensioner of all the three categories receive Rs. 1000 (Rupees one thousand) per month.
IGNOAPS (Indira Gandhi National Old Age Pension Scheme) : Persons whose age is 60 years or more and who live below poverty line are eligible to apply for this pension. Economic status is determined by deprivation level of the applicant’s family as per Socio-Economic Caste Census-2011. Whose deprivation level is at least 3 is eligible to apply. Department of Panchayats & Rural Development, Government of West Bengal publishes list of prospective beneficiaries from time to time. Physical verification of such cases is conducted by Govt./Panchayat officials and eligible persons are considered for pension. Application may also be submitted through UMANG/SAMBAL App or website (nsap.nic.in).
IGNWPS (Indira Gandhi National Widow Pension Scheme): Widows between the age group of 40-59 and who live below poverty line are eligible to apply for this pension. Economic status is determined by deprivation level of the applicant’s family as per Socio-Economic Caste Census-2011. Whose deprivation level is at least 2 is eligible to apply. Department of Panchayats & Rural Development, Government of West Bengal publishes list of prospective beneficiaries from time to time. Physical verification of such cases is conducted by Govt./Panchayat officials and eligible persons are considered for pension. Application may also be submitted through UMANG/SAMBAL App or website (nsap.nic.in). When Beneficiaries under this scheme attain the age of 60, they are automatically converted to IGNOAPS.
IGNDPS (Indira Gandhi National Disability Pension Scheme): Disable persons having Disability Certificate whose age is 18 years or more and who live below poverty line are eligible to apply for this pension. Economic status is determined by deprivation level of the applicant’s family as per Socio-Economic Caste Census-2011. Whose deprivation level is at least 2 is eligible to apply. Application may be submitted through UMANG/SAMBAL App or website (nsap.nic.in).
NFBS (National Family Benefit Scheme): If the main bread winner of any family living below poverty line dies between the age of 18 to 59, the family gets a lump sum financial assistance amounting Rs. 40000 under this scheme. Application in desired format is to be submitted to the office of the Gram Panchayat within two months of death. Application forms are available with Gram Panchayat Office.
